A Symbol That Connects the Muslim Ummah
The Holy Kaaba is the spiritual center of Islam and the Qiblah toward which Muslims turn during every prayer. The Kaaba Kiswah enhances this sacred landmark with its elegant black silk and beautifully embroidered Quranic verses. It reminds Muslims that, despite differences in culture, language, and nationality, they are united in worshipping Allah and following the teachings of Islam.
